The CRC or the placement cell of Amity Mumbai are always in search of good internships and placements for their students. The internship offered by Amity Mumbai is at great hospitals, rehab centres, under renowned psychologist/psychiatrists. I am not really sure of placement possibilities in Amity Mumbai for Psychology as there are very few places which take students after graduation. Even if they're there, they might pay you very less.
